Amateurs Only Tournament on Feb 6th CANCELED
Wednesday, 27 January 2010
We have canceled our Amateurs Only tournament on February 6th at Roosevelt due to floating debris.  I took a ride up there and took a look and that lake is a mess right now and I don't expect it to clear up any time soon.  We don't need damaged lower units or worse, people getting hurt out there.  I'll see if I can find a date to reschedule it if possible. - Jack Lewis, Tournament Director

JackAZ Bass Elite Series and Amateurs Only Schedule Changes
Wednesday, 23 December 2009

We had to make some tournament lake and date changes due to low water levels, uncertain future water levels and overlap with other circuits. 

We now have all our TNF permits for JackAZ 2009-10 tournaments.

Elite Series Changes

Jan. 16th moved from Bartlett to Roosevelt - Schoolhouse

Mar. 20th moved from San Carlos to Mar. 13th at Bartlett

Apr. 24th moved to May 8th, still at Roosevelt - Windy Hill

Amateurs Only Changes

Feb. 6th previously moved from Bartlett to Roosevelt - Windy Hill

Antolos & Amos Win the Amateurs Only at Bartlet 10/31/09
Monday, 02 November 2009
Image
Antolos and Amos with their winning limit of 11.67lbs
Windy and cold weather greeted anglers on Saturday morning and the whitecaps didn't die down until mid morning.  But the fishing was pretty good with almost all teams weighing in a limit.  Cranks and blades while the wind was blowing and then plastics once the wind died down is what we hear was catching them. Congratulations to the team of J. Antolos and B. Amos for winning Saturday's JackAZ Amateurs Only Tournament at Bartlett.  Their limit weighed 11.67 lbs and they took home a check for $1400.  60 boats fished on Saturday and our thanks to all of them for fishing JackAZ.  For full results Click Here .  Pictures are available Here .  Our next Amateurs Only Tournament is December 5th at Bartlett. - Jack Lewis, tournament director
